54 Herculis is an orange K-type giant 392 light-years away in the body of Hercules. Its light left the surface when it was still debated whether the Earth turned. Today it is measured by probes such as Gaia, modern heirs to the first parallaxes done by eye and photographic plate. A star of copper calm, settled, with no dramatic flourishes in its hue.
